1. Relieve Pain

One of the main reasons women choose to undergo this plastic surgery is to alleviate the pain caused by their large breasts. When there’s excess weight on your chest, this can cause stress to your neck, shoulders, and back.

2. Less Pain When Exercising

As previously mentioned, if you live an active lifestyle, you know that your breasts can get in the way and make exercising uncomfortable. This is especially true for activities where you’re frequently jumping or bouncing, like running or dancing.

Even the world’s best sports bras can’t help make your hiking, yoga, or weight training less painful, so opting to speak with a plastic surgeon about your options is a great way to get back to the things you love.

3. Aesthetic Appearance

For many women with a larger chest, clothing shopping can be challenging. You likely can’t wear many of the shirts other women can, as your breasts make the top too obscene, tight, or uncomfortable. Similarly, you may not be able to wear the top the correct way.

However, this cosmetic surgery can help decrease your cup size, helping your chest look more proportional to the rest of your body. This means you’ll feel more confident, as you can wear the clothes you want without worrying about your chest.

4. Increased Hygiene

If your breasts are larger than average, you may find they come into more contact with the skin beneath. This means you’re more prone to infections, rashes, and skin discomfort.

Reducing your cup size also reduces the risk of irritation, as your skin folds aren’t as dramatic. This means you can increase your hygiene as you won’t worry about sweat, dirt, and bacteria hiding underneath your breasts.
